The ribs turned out pretty good... not super incredibly fatastic... but pretty darn good.

I had an issue with the edges of the riblolator tray dragging on the edge of the expansion ring. No matter how I adjusted, it's about a 1/8 inch too tight. Ideas? I'm thinking of just getting the dremel tool and angling off the corners.

Do any of you foil using the ribolator? I thought about it, but decided against it. The ribs were just a tad dry... maybe I need to mist them more often with apple juice.

I'm thinking that if I would have installed a lid thermometer, it would have interfered with the trays. Anyone experience this?

All in all, it was a good cook... it took longer than I thought.. about 5.5 hours. I had some initial trouble keeping the temps up. I just didn't use enough coal because I was worried about the air gap with the expansion ring.
